Physical Characteristics & Chemical Composition:

The Pink Rolex pill is described as small and pink, often compared to a smoker's lolly or a pencil eraser. A crucial piece of information is its reported weight of approximately 522mg. However, the most critical aspect is the reported presence of approximately 155mg of N-Isopropyl butylone (also known as NBI). N-Isopropyl butylone is a novel psychoactive substance, meaning it's a relatively new synthetic drug not extensively studied or regulated. This lack of research presents significant challenges in understanding its short-term and long-term effects on the human body. The unpredictability of its effects is a major concern.

The Dangers of Novel Psychoactive Substances (NPS):

The use of NPS like N-Isopropyl butylone carries inherent risks. Because these substances are relatively new, their effects are often poorly understood. This means users cannot accurately predict the intensity or duration of the high, leading to potentially dangerous situations. Furthermore, the purity and exact composition of NPS are rarely consistent. A pill labeled as containing a specific amount of a single substance might, in reality, contain varying amounts of that substance, along with other unknown or untested chemicals – cutting agents or other drugs – that can significantly alter the effects and increase the risk of adverse reactions.

Resources for Identification and Information:

Understanding the risks associated with the Pink Rolex pill requires access to reliable information. Several resources exist to help identify unknown pills and provide information on their potential effects:

* Rolex Pill Images: While a simple image search might yield pictures of pills resembling the description, the visual similarity alone is not enough for identification. Slight variations in color, size, or markings can indicate different compositions. Relying solely on visual comparison is extremely risky.

* The '10 strongest' ecstasy pills tested by drugs charity: This type of report, if available for the Pink Rolex pill, would provide valuable data on its potency relative to other ecstasy pills. However, it's crucial to remember that even "stronger" pills don't necessarily mean a more enjoyable or safer experience; they simply indicate a higher concentration of psychoactive substances, increasing the risk of adverse reactions.

* Pill library: Online pill libraries, often associated with harm reduction organizations, attempt to compile images and information on various pills seized or tested. These databases can help in identifying a pill's potential composition, but their accuracy depends on the information submitted and verified.
